Valiant Harbor International is seeking a Software Engineer to support the United States Air Force. This role is ideal for a highly technical and innovative software engineer with experience designing, developing, and optimizing full-stack solutions to support advanced DoD initiatives in a secure, mission-critical environment.
Job Responsibilities
• Design, develop and maintain software solutions using a variety of programming languages, depending on the project needs.
• Write clean, efficient and well-documented code that adheres to industry standards and best practices across languages.
• Develop scripts and programs to Integrate enterprise applications and related databases.
• Maintain version control and code integrity with the use of Git, ensuring consistency in multi-language projects.
• Debug, test and optimize applications across platforms and environments to ensure high performance and security.
• Troubleshoot and resolve complex technical issues, often involving interactions between systems written in different languages.
• Optimize software architectures to meet performance benchmarks, using tooling and metrics to evaluate execution efficiency.
• Document technical designs, code logic and integration points for maintainability and knowledge sharing.
• Adapt quickly to new technologies and frameworks, applying the right language or tool for the problem defined by the customer.
• Take part in code reviews by providing constructive feedback across language domains.
• Support the development and maintenance of common libraries and shared tools across multiple software teams.
• Define client's objectives by analyzing user requirements, envisioning system features and functionality.
• Collaborate with stakeholders to inform them of system design and development.
• Analyze and decompose software requirements across system components and subcomponents.
• Managing the complete software development process from conception to deployment.
• Develop roadmaps, strategic design plans, and system architecture documentation.
• Capture, refine, and document reference architectures and ensure compliance with cybersecurity and development standards.
• Provide recommendations on tools and system solutions based upon industry standards and best practices.
• Ensure the completion of application development by coordinating schedules, identifying risks and mitigation strategies, contributing to team meetings, and troubleshooting development and production issues across multiple environments and operating platforms.
• Participate in weekly meetings with internal technical manager to provide stakeholder's work status updates.
• Collaborate with stakeholders to formulate strategies for agile prototyping and scalable deployment.
• Remain current on DevSecOps practices, emerging design patterns, and system architecture trends.
• Work directly with stakeholders and product owners to define requirements and build product lines.
Job Requirements
• Must have a current SECRET security clearance prior to selection. NOTE: This position requires the successful candidate to obtain a TOP SECRET security clearance with SCI Eligibility after selection.
•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related STEM discipline.
• 7-10 years of engineering experience in full-stack software development, including Linux/Unix proficiency, and at least two (2) years of Java and XML experience.
• Proven experience designing and building scalable, secure, and high-performance software systems.
• Problem solver and strong learner, willing to become a SME and train others.
• Able to work in the office 3–4 days per week.
• Available for frequent travel.
• Former military or familiarity with the DoD environment (ideally with SIPR/JWICS exposure).
